The new FDI class - Frigate Admiral Ronarc'h

henrikbattke

The French frigate Admiral Ronarc'h is the first vessel in the French Navy's new Frégate de Défense et d'Intervention (FDI) class, marking a significant step in the modernization of the fleet. As the lead ship of this cutting-edge class, the Admiral Ronarc'h is designed to address contemporary naval warfare challenges while maintaining versatility across a wide range of missions. The FDI class comprises five medium-sized frigates, each slightly smaller and more cost-effective than the French/Italian FREMM-class frigates, offering a balanced approach between capability and affordability.

Expected to enter service in 2025, the Admiral Ronarc'h boasts an advanced weapon system, starting with its vertical launching system (VLS), capable of deploying various missile systems to counter aerial, surface, and submarine threats. In addition to the VLS, the ship is equipped with two twin torpedo tubes for anti-submarine warfare, further enhancing its defensive and offensive capabilities. Its firepower is complemented by a 76 mm rapid-fire cannon from OTO Melara (now Leonardo), ensuring formidable surface engagement capability.


On the ship's stern, a versatile landing platform accommodates both helicopters and drones, enabling aerial operations for reconnaissance, transport, and anti-submarine missions. This adaptability extends the Admiral Ronarc'h's reach, making it suitable for a range of naval operations, including escort, patrol, and intervention missions.

Our 3D model of the Admiral Ronarc'h, built in Blender, comes in three levels of detail (LOD). The model showcased here, LOD0, features 48,070 polygons, balancing between visual appearance and performance. It includes three distinct texture sets, each optimized for realism. The primary texture set, Main0, utilizes a 4K resolution with a density of 40 pixels per meter, ensuring high-quality visuals suitable for close-up views in various simulation environments.
